(adj) :
Of or pertaining to a vestiary or vestments.
(n) :
A member of a monastery responsible for making, caring for, and distributing habits.
(n) :
(historical) During the vestiarian controversy, a supporter of the wearing of vestments by the clergy (as opposed to an anti-vestiarian who considered the wearing of vestments a form of idolatry).
